How big is the LA Auto Show?

1,000,000 square feet
Founded in 1907, the Los Angeles Auto Show (LA Auto Show®), is one of the most influential and best-attended auto shows globally and spans more than 1,000,000 square feet.

Where is the largest car show in America?

The Chicago Auto Show
The Chicago Auto Show – Nation’s Largest One This show has quite a history – it has been held more times than any other exposition of autos in North America, and it’s still the largest one. It takes place in Chicago, Illinois, and it utilizes more than one million square feet in the McCormick Place complex.
